(4) DIRECTING THE CIRCULATION.
Lying down or sitting erect, breathe rhythmically, and with the exhalations direct the circulation to any part you wish, which may be suffering from imperfect circulation.

This is effective in cases of cold feet or in cases of headache, the blood being sent downward in both cases, in the first case warming the feet, and in the latter, relieving the brain from too great pressure.

In the case of headache, try the Pain Inhibiting first, then follow with sending the blood downward.

You will often feel a warm feeling in the legs as the circulation moves downward.

The circulation is largely under the control of the will and rhythmic breathing renders the task easier.
